Objective
Seeks to provide returns that match the return of the Underlying ETF, up to the upside cap of 16.97%, while providing a buffer against the first 9% of losses.
Strategy
Invests primarily in FLEX Options referencing the Underlying ETF to provide a buffer against the first 9% of losses and an upside cap of 16.97%. The strategy targets large capitalization U.S. equity securities, specifically the S&P 500, to achieve these outcomes.
